Archaeology Notes

NT24SE 31 c.270 419.

Coles notes a sandstone slab, c.3' square with 2 cup-and-one-ring up to 4" diameter, and a ring mark, the rings being unusually wide, situated at the foot of a high gravel bank, the E bank of the Kittlegairy Burn, midway between a sheep-shelter which stood at NT 2669 4189 (see NT24SE 29) and the fort at NT 2749 4206. This stone was not found in 1960 by the RCAHMS or in 1967.

F R Coles 1899; R W B Morris 1969

Not located. Much of the area indicated has been afforested.

Visited by OS (JP) 18 October 1974
